Transaction 35fbdf98c7204029fe2bd4e78590ea24acbbc95e5ffda3d55b26fcca594ca149

1 Input
2 Outputs
  • 35fbdf98c7204029fe2bd4e78590ea24acbbc95e5ffda3d55b26fcca594ca149:0
  • value  19916535
    address  1HdKw8b2gTtCGsGuKi5mpz21swSvfVfkMw
  • 35fbdf98c7204029fe2bd4e78590ea24acbbc95e5ffda3d55b26fcca594ca149:1
  • value  104080977
    address  3D9138bH6Xtr2rYbdoXvaSwLoSvAG1he1D